ArgoCD Diff Preview is a Go CLI tool that generates diffs between Argo CD application manifests across Git branches. It uses Argo CD to do the rendering. The applications are applied to the cluster. But never synced, so the tracked resources are never actually created in the cluster. This allows us to get the rendered manifests with all the transformations applied, without actually creating any resources in the cluster.

Do NOT add issue numbers in parentheses to commit messages or PR titles. The (#123) format is what GitHub automatically adds when merging/squashing PRs (and it refers to the PR number, not the issue).

- A repository can contain multiple applications and applications with the same name. We ALWAYS need to make sure the names are unique.
- We can not make any assumption of how the code i structured and how many applications are stored in the same file.
